There’s nothing like listening to a shower and thinking how it is soaking in around your green beans. —Marcelene Cox, American author While one of the most iconic uses for the ever-popular green bean is in a creamy casserole at the holidays, fresh, local beans purchased in season at your local market can’t be beat. Also called snap beans or string beans, green beans actually come in a range of colors, from green to yellow to purple. What you get Green beans are a tasty low-calorie vegetable with fiber and a wide array of nutrients, such as vitamins A and C. Tips Shopping Tips When buying fresh green beans, look for brightly colored beans that appear fresh, are tender but firm, and snap easily when bent.

Haricots verts is simply French for “green beans.” Storage Tip Refrigerate in a plastic bag for 3 to 5 days. Paprika Shrimp & Green Bean Saute Recipe. Best White Icing Ever Recipe.

September 11, 2008 | By Adam Roberts | 25 Comments My first experience with cranberry beans was a failed attempt at a soup (see here) where dried cranberry beans were cooked for an inappropriate amount of time, leading to a texture so unpleasantly undercooked it was like eating unpopped popcorn kernels.

The years have passed, but the scars took a while to heal: I wasn’t too eager to cook cranberry beans again. Not even fresh ones. That is until I saw a beautiful mound of them at the farmer’s market and, knowing I was cooking a dinner for Stella two weeks ago, I said: “What the ‘ell!” (I had a British accent.) Cranberry beans are so, so, pretty, you just want to stare at them and not cook them for hours. “Sorry, Stella!” But look at the open pod in my hand: Can you believe that comes from nature? I spent a pleasant 20 minutes shelling all the beans into this bowl and, again, found myself mesmerized by their beauty: Stella smacked me again. “I’m sorry, Stella!”

Calculating Grades Overview In the Grade Center, an Instructor can calculate grades by combining multiple columns to attain performance results, such as class averages, final grades that are based on a weighted scale, or total points, and so on. These are called Calculated Columns. These columns, which display performance results, can be displayed to students or remain accessible to only the Instructor, TA, and Grader. The possible Calculated Columns include the following: Weighted GradeAverageTotal Minimum/Maximum These can be used at the Instructor’s discretion to create any calculation that may facilitate the Instructor’s organization, measurement or vigilance of a Course. About Weighted Grades A Weighted Grade is a Calculated Column that displays the calculated result of quantities and their respective percentages. Instructors can create any number of Weighted Grade columns, including Weighted Grade columns that include other Weighted Grade columns.

Simple Weighted Grade Workflow. Week 17: Meatless Meal Recipe Contest Winner. Have you ever heard of quinoa? (pronounced keen-waw) This ancient grain is a nutritional powerhouse and is the cornerstone of the award-winning recipe this week. Quinoa contains more protein than any other grain. In fact, the protein is of an unusually high quality – it is a complete protein, with an essential amino acid balance close to ideal. Quinoa can be substituted for almost any grain in a recipe and can be found in both red or white varieties. Huge round of applause for our latest winner, Susan Shipe! Kale is one of the greens that you should be including in your diet. Just remember that kale is one of the greens that you should be buying organic as kale may contain organophosphate insecticides, which EWG characterizes as “highly toxic” and of special concern. We all know that cabbage is one of the cruciferous veggies that are so good for us and purple cabbage has an even higher concentration of anthocyanin polyphenols, which are significantly more protective phytonutrients than green cabbage.
